ALEXANDRIA, Va., Feb. 17 -- United States Patent no. 12,557,033, issued on Feb. 17, was assigned to QUALCOMM Inc. (San Diego).

"Antenna-aware energy reservation for radio frequency exposure compliance" was invented by Michel Chauvin (San Diego), Arnaud Meylan (San Diego), Aman Arora (San Diego), Sai Krishna Boyapati (Hyderabad, India) and Tianpei Chen (San Diego).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"Certain aspects of the present disclosure provide techniques and apparatus for antenna-aware energy reservation for radio frequency (RF) exposure compliance.
